GST Registration for Foreigners Online India Application Process
The process for GST registration for foreigners online India involves the following steps:
- Access the GST Portal: Visit www.gst.gov.in and select 'New Registration'.
- Choose 'Non-Resident Taxable Person': Under the 'I am a' dropdown, select 'Non-Resident Taxable Person'.
- Fill Part A: Provide basic details such as name, email, mobile number, and PAN (if applicable). For foreign entities without PAN, a temporary reference number is generated.
- OTP Verification: Verify the email and mobile number via OTP.
- Fill Part B: Submit detailed information including business details, authorized signatory, and place of business in India.
- Upload Documents: Upload scanned copies of required documents (see Key Forms section).
- Submit Application: After verification, submit the application. An Application Reference Number (ARN) is generated.
- Verification by Officer: The GST officer verifies the application and may seek additional information. Upon approval, a GSTIN is issued.
Key Forms Required for GST Registration for Foreigners Online India
The following forms are required for GST registration for foreigners online India:
- Form GST REG-01: Application for registration (Part A and Part B).
- Form GST REG-02: Acknowledgment of application.
- Form GST REG-06: Certificate of registration (issued after approval).
Documents required:
- Passport copy (for individual foreigner)
- Proof of business registration in home country
- Address proof of place of business in India (if any)
- Bank account details (Indian bank account or foreign account with IFSC)
- Photograph of the applicant
- Authorization letter for the authorized signatory
